股骨头置换术中骨水泥对患者凝血功能、骨折愈合和术后关节功能的影响

Effect of bone cement on coagulation function, fracture healing and postoperative joint function in patients undergoing femoral head replacement

【摘要】 目的探究股骨头置换术中应用骨水泥对患者凝血功能、骨折愈合进度和术后关节功能的影响。方法回顾性分析2016年1月至2017年2月在黄石市中心医院骨关节外科进行股骨头置换手术的156例患者的诊疗资料,根据其股骨头材料的不同分为生物型组(对照组)和骨水泥组(观察组),每组78例。比较两组患者的手术时间、出血量和凝血功能相关指标,同时,比较两组患者术后关节功能、骨折愈合进度及近远期并发症发生率。结果观察组患者的手术时间明显长于对照组,差异有统计学意义(P<0.05),而其术中出血量、术后引流量、输血量及卧床时间明显高于对照组,差异均有统计学意义(P<0.05);治疗后,两组患者凝血酶原时间(PT)、激活部分凝血酶原时间(APTT)水平明显降低,且观察组明显低于对照组,差异均有统计学意义(P<0.05);两组患者的纤维蛋白原(FIB)、血小板(PLT)水平明显升高,且观察组高于对照组,差异均有统计学意义(P<0.05);术前,两组患者的Harris评分和Barthel评分比较差异均无统计学意义(P>0.05),术后3个月,观察组患者的Harris评分及Barthel评分明显高于对照组,差异均有统计学意义(P<0.05),但术后6个月,两组患者的Harris评分和Barthel评分比较差异均无统计学意义(P>0.05);两组患者的近期并发症发生率比较差异无统计学意义(P>0.05),但观察组患者的远期并发症发生率仅为5.13%,明显低于对照组的15.38%,差异具有统计学意义(P<0.05)。结论股骨头置换术中应用骨水泥可以明显改善患者的凝血功能,加快骨折愈合,促进患者关节功能的恢复,具有较好的近期疗效。

【Abstract】 Objective To investigate the effect of bone cement on coagulation function, fracture healing progress and postoperative joint function in patients undergoing femoral head replacement. Methods A retrospective analysis of 156 patients was conducted, who underwent femoral head replacement surgery in the Department of Osteoarticular Surgery in Huangshi Central Hospital from January 2016 to February 2017. They were divided into biotype groups(control group) and bone cement group(observation group) according to the different materials of the femoral head, with 78 cases in each group. The operation time, blood loss and coagulation function related indexes were compared between the two groups. At the same time, the postoperative joint function, fracture healing progress and the incidence of short-term and long-term complications were compared between the two groups. Results The operation time of the observation group was significantly longer than that of the control group, while the intraoperative blood loss, postoperative drainage volume, blood transfusion volume and bed rest time were significantly higher than those of the control group(P<0.05).After treatment, the levels of prothrombin time(PT) and activated partial prothrombin time(APTT) were significantly reduced in both groups, and the data of observation group was significantly lower than that of the control group(P<0.05).The levels of fibrinogen(FIB) and platelet(PLT) were significantly increased in both groups, and the results of observation group were higher than those of the control group(P<0.05). There were no significant differences in Harris score and Barthel score between the two groups before surgery(P>0.05); at 3 months after operation, the Harris score and Barthel score of the observation group were significantly higher than those of the control group(P<0.05); but at 6 months after surgery, there were no significant differences in Harris score and Barthel score between the two groups again(P>0.05). There was no statistically significant difference in the incidence of recent complications between the two groups(P>0.05), however, the long-term complication rate of the observation group was only 5.13%, which was significantly lower than 15.38 of the control group(P<0.05). Conclusion The application of bone cement in the replacement of femoral head can significantly improve the coagulation function of the patients, accelerate the healing of the fracture, and promote the recovery of joint function in patients. It has a good short-term effect and is worthy of clinical application.
